2010 Pee Wee Coaches

All persons wishing to coach Pee Wee (past and present), please fill out the coaching application and criminal record check.

Please note the hours of operation to obtain your criminal record check will be 8am-7pm (Mon-Fri) and 11am-3pm (Sat) at the Grande Prairie RCMP station.

You will need to bring the following:

-2 pieces of government issued ID

-1 with picture and both with your DOB (date of birth)

-examples being- drivers license, AHC, or passport

-filled out Pee Wee form in order to qualify for the non-profit organization fee to be waived.

Please note that any persons wishing to be on the field must be an accepted coach.

For the safety of our players,any persons that are not on the coaching staff will be asked to remove themselves from the practice field and or game bench.

NATA “Heads Up” DVD   

The Head's Up DVD is designed to be an educational/instructional tool for football players. Although it was designed with this audience in mind, it has plenty to offer anyone with an interest in football, including coaches, officials, administrators, parents and medical professionals. The DVD addresses the dangers of head-down contact and spearing along with contact techniques that reduce the risk of catastrophic head and neck injuries.

It is available for free viewing/downloading or the DVD can be purchased for $10 at the NATA web site. It builds upon two previous video's on this topic "Prevent Paralysis: Don't Hit with Your Head" and "See What You Hit". In addition to catastrophic cervical spine injuries the Heads Up DVD was designed to address catastrophic head injuries and correct contact techniques. It also addresses the contact techniques of all players including ball carriers, blockers, and special teams players
